Major Hometown Glasgow Gig For Christopher Macarthur Boyd

After selling out the entire run of his highly acclaimed new show Howling At The Moon at this year’s Edinburgh Fringe Christopher Macarthur Boyd will be taking it to the famous King’s Theatre in Glasgow on 19th March 2026.

He’ll bring his totally unique, ‘belly-achingly funny’ (Herald) stand-up about grappling with being mental, his sexuality and general lunacy. 

It’s been a busy year or so for Christopher between breaking up with his long-term girlfriend and moving back in with his parents in the east end of Glasgow, and he’s doing stand-up about his love life and grief and nostalgia. 

Christopher sold out his debut tour last year and became a co-host on the hit podcast Here Comes The Guillotine (with Frankie Boyle and Susie McCabe) 

Christopher is making big waves on the comedy scene right now. He’s a ‘compelling’ (Times) observational standup who is happy to deliver the latest headlines of his life, with his signature style of comedy.

Christopher has released his comedy special Oh No on 800 Pound Gorilla Media and he recorded his last critically acclaimed show Scary Times at the 1400 seat Pavilion Theatre in Glasgow, which is now available to view on the Some Laughs Youtube channel. He recently hosted BBC New Comedy Awards and Scotland Stands Up. As well as his own tour, he has supported: Frankie Boyle, Susie McCabe, Kevin Bridges, Shane Gillis and David Cross.”
